Doris Glick gives Mudick's store full interior decorator treatment

NEW YORK - Doris Glick, an interior decorator who has been surrounded by the shoe industry for most of her life, recently completed her third design project for Eric Mudick, who co-owns five Eric shoe stores here, with his father, Bert Mudick.

Glick, an interior decorator for 27 years who presently is redesigning a fourth Mudick store, located at 76th Street, is married to Marx & Newman president Howard Glick and is the daughter of a shoe manufacturer.
